For MBA admissions at SIBM Nagpur, the important dates usually begin with SNAP registration around August to November, followed by the SNAP exam in December. Shortlisted candidates are then called for GE-PI-WAT rounds between January and February. Final merit lists are typically released by March. You can check the latest schedule on the official site for accuracy.

While registering for the SNAP entrance examination, candidates are required to pay the application fee of INR 2,250 via credit/debit card or net banking. Moreover, at the time of using the SNAP ID and filling out the SBIM Nagpur MBA application, candidates are required to pay the application fee for the institution and course, which is INR 1000.

Yes, SIBM Nagpur does offer seat reservations for MBA courses. Most of the seats are reserved for the candidates belonging to unreserved categories. Check out the number of seats reserved in MBA course below:
Category | Seat Reservation (in %) |
|---|---|
SC | 15 |
ST | 7.5 |
PwD | 3 |
International Students | 15 |
Note: Apart from the above reservations, two seats in each programme are reserved for Kashmiri migrants.

In case the candidate withdraws admission at SIBM Nagpur by or before a certain fixed date, the student is eligible for full refund in respect of academic fees including refundable deposits, deducting the actual cost charged to him by the institute (if any). The procedure is followed as per guidelines of University Grants Commission where flexibility is given to them and monetary help to choose not to continue the program. The policy covers the student from incurring any financial loss in case he or she withdraws before this date. It covers all students who are applying for admission in the 2025.

To get admission in SIBM Nagpur for MBA is through Symbiosis National Aptitude Test. Test is held annually in November-December & entire process is online.
Website provides application link until the deadline where a student can fill their application form. Those students who are shortlisted participate in group exercises, interviews & written ability test.

During 2025 placements, the highest package offered to MBA and MBA FABM students was INR 24.9 LPA and INR 18 LPA, respectively. Take a look at the table below to know the SIBM Nagpur highest placement package for the past three years:
| Particulars | Placement Statistics (2023) | Placement Statistics (2024) | Placement Statistics (2025) |
|---|---|---|---|
| Highest package | INR 18 LPA (MBA) | - INR 20 LPA (MBA) - INR 18 LPA (MBA FABM) | - INR 24.9 LPA (MBA) - INR 18 LPA (MBA FABM) |
